Facilitated by Christopher Phillips, bestselling author and civil discourse advocate
Public dialogue exploring the state of information and news services in Salina and the need for free access and expression.
This event is part of "Coyote Speaks," a series of participant-focused community dialogues in Salina. Support is provided through the Kansas Town Hall program, a partnership between Humanities Kansas and the Eisenhower Presidential Library & Museum.
